Gabriel Montenegro

Since 2021, Gabriel Montenegro is a Research and Standards Engineer for Samsung Research America, and a Member of the Board of Directors of Invest Pacific. He is the Chair for the 2021-2022 IETF NomCom. He was a Principal Architect/Developer/Program Manager in networking technologies for Windows at Microsoft from 2005-2020. From 1990-2005, he worked at Sun Microsystems as a Principal Researcher at Sunlabs in Grenoble, France and Mountain View, California. In the IETF/IRTF, Gabriel is a past IAB member and has co-authored 18 RFCs and chaired BoFs and Working Groups in several areas (Internet, Applications, Security, Transport). He also represented Microsoft at the Wi-Fi Alliance, USB-IF (USB Implementer’s Forum, as editor of MBIM 1.x), IEEE 802.1, IEEE 802.11, 802.21 and WiMAX Forum. Gabriel has a B.S. EE-Computers from Stanford University, USA and an M.S. Information Engineering from Niigata University, Japan. Gabriel has lived in 4 countries, and speaks 5 languages.
